[quote=Anonymous]Do not wait until spring. fall is the best time for turf growth. use selective herbicides on the turf to eradicate the nasties and the plan on aeration and overseed stay away from the county provided free stuff. you will not be happy and you will be importing more weeds back to your property. rather than a coke bottle. put on a rubber glove, and then put on a cotton glove overtop of the rubber glove or use a sponge and wipe the herbicide on the vines and such that are close to the desirable shrubs with minimal damage. if its as bad as you say it is. id just spray and think about replacing the entire landscape anyhow... the shrubs you try to save might not be worth saving once you get things cleared up. don't waste time with the cardboard.
